Having actually seen its popularity continuously decline over the last 20 years, Wednesday's ballot can be a landmark minute when the celebration as soon as led by Nelson Mandela goes down listed below 50% of the elect the very first time. Numerous surveys have the ANC's support at less than 50%, elevating the opportunity that it will need to form a nationwide coalition.


"Democrats, pals, are you ready for change?" Steenhuisen said. The group screamed back "Yes!" "Are you ready to rescue South Africa?" Steenhuisen added. While the ANC's assistance has actually diminished in three succeeding nationwide political elections and shows up set to continue going down, no event has arised to overtake it or perhaps test it and it is still extensively anticipated to be the biggest event by some way in this election.

South Africa has lots of celebrations signed up to object to following week's political election. South Africans elect celebrations and not straight for their president in national elections. Events then get seats in Parliament according to their share of the vote and the legislators choose the president which is why the ANC shedding its majority would certainly be so vital to the 71-year-old Ramaphosa's hope of being reelected for a 2nd and last five-year term.

The 82-year-old Zuma shook South African national politics when he announced late in 2014 he was turning his back on the ANC and joining MK, while increasingly slamming the ANC under Ramaphosa. Zuma has actually been invalidated from standing as a prospect for Parliament in the political election as a result of a previous criminal conviction.




Johannesburg For 2 weeks, Tsholofelo Moloi has actually been amongst thousands of South Africans lining up for water as the nation's largest city, Johannesburg, confronts an unmatched collapse of its water supply impacting numerous people. Homeowners rich and bad have actually never seen a lack of this severity (South African current events). While hot climate has reduced reservoirs, falling apart framework after decades of disregard is additionally mainly to condemn


A country already popular for its is currently adopting a term called "watershedding" the practice of do without water, from the term loadshedding, or the technique of going without power. Moloi, a citizen of Soweto on the borders of Johannesburg, isn't sure she or her neighbors can take a lot more.

Outraged lobbyists and homeowners say this crisis has actually been years in the production. They condemn authorities' inadequate administration and the failure to preserve aging water facilities. Much of it dates to the years following the end of apartheid, when basic solutions were increased to the nation's look at these guys Black population in an era of optimism.


In Johannesburg, run by a union of political events, temper is find out versus authorities as a whole as people ask yourself just how upkeep of a few of the country's essential financial engines went astray. A record published in 2015 by the national division of water and sanitation is darning. Its monitoring of water use by towns discovered that 40% of Johannesburg's water is lost via leaks, which consists of ruptured pipelines.
